aboutsummaryrefslogtreecommitdiff
path: root/audio/streamtuner
diff options
context:
space:
mode:
authorJoe Marcus Clarke <marcus@FreeBSD.org>2007-10-24 23:37:25 +0000
committerJoe Marcus Clarke <marcus@FreeBSD.org>2007-10-24 23:37:25 +0000
commit4acc6fb2a411b291c9c210d82bafe7c62e71c77d (patch)
treebc16420eb52d65511ceb520c00171d219210a473 /audio/streamtuner
parent97dfcc1b41c5b4581b1d73128a866beec069c5bf (diff)
downloadports-4acc6fb2a411b291c9c210d82bafe7c62e71c77d.tar.gz
ports-4acc6fb2a411b291c9c210d82bafe7c62e71c77d.zip
Notes
Diffstat (limited to 'audio/streamtuner')
-rw-r--r--audio/streamtuner/Makefile9
-rw-r--r--audio/streamtuner/pkg-plist85
2 files changed, 48 insertions, 46 deletions
diff --git a/audio/streamtuner/Makefile b/audio/streamtuner/Makefile
index fd3ab322db8f..b81254a014f3 100644
--- a/audio/streamtuner/Makefile
+++ b/audio/streamtuner/Makefile
@@ -7,7 +7,7 @@
PORTNAME= streamtuner
PORTVERSION= 0.99.99
-PORTREVISION= 7
+PORTREVISION= 9
CATEGORIES= audio www
MASTER_SITES= ${MASTER_SITE_SAVANNAH}
MASTER_SITE_SUBDIR= ${PORTNAME}
@@ -15,14 +15,15 @@ MASTER_SITE_SUBDIR= ${PORTNAME}
MAINTAINER= jylefort@FreeBSD.org
COMMENT= A GTK+ stream directory browser
-BUILD_DEPENDS= scrollkeeper-config:${PORTSDIR}/textproc/scrollkeeper
+BUILD_DEPENDS= rarian-sk-config:${PORTSDIR}/textproc/rarian
LIB_DEPENDS= curl:${PORTSDIR}/ftp/curl
RUN_DEPENDS= ${LOCALBASE}/libdata/pkgconfig/gnome-icon-theme.pc:${PORTSDIR}/misc/gnome-icon-theme
USE_XLIB= yes
USE_GNOME= gtk20 gnomehack gnomeprefix
USE_GMAKE= yes
-GNU_CONFIGURE= yes
+INSTALLS_OMF= yes
+GNU_CONFIGURE= yes
USE_GETOPT_LONG= yes
CPPFLAGS= -I${LOCALBASE}/include
LDFLAGS= -L${LOCALBASE}/lib
@@ -85,5 +86,7 @@ USE_GNOME+= pygtk2
post-patch:
@${REINPLACE_CMD} -e 's|echo aout|echo elf|' ${WRKSRC}/configure
+ @${REINPLACE_CMD} -e 's|[(]datadir[)]/help|(datadir)/gnome/help|g' \
+ ${WRKSRC}/help/C/Makefile.in
.include <bsd.port.post.mk>
diff --git a/audio/streamtuner/pkg-plist b/audio/streamtuner/pkg-plist
index 49b9461ba2df..4aea575d4a33 100644
--- a/audio/streamtuner/pkg-plist
+++ b/audio/streamtuner/pkg-plist
@@ -24,6 +24,7 @@ include/streamtuner/streamtuner.h
%%SHOUTCAST%%lib/streamtuner/plugins/shoutcast.so
%%XIPH%%lib/streamtuner/plugins/xiph.so
libdata/pkgconfig/streamtuner.pc
+share/applications/streamtuner.desktop
share/doc/streamtuner/api-reference.html
share/doc/streamtuner/ch01s02.html
share/doc/streamtuner/home.png
@@ -53,58 +54,56 @@ share/doc/streamtuner/streamtuner-st-util-api.html
share/doc/streamtuner/streamtuner-st-version-api.html
share/doc/streamtuner/streamtuner.devhelp
share/doc/streamtuner/up.png
-share/gnome/applications/streamtuner.desktop
share/gnome/help/streamtuner/C/documentation-license.xml
share/gnome/help/streamtuner/C/figures/main-window.png
share/gnome/help/streamtuner/C/software-license.xml
share/gnome/help/streamtuner/C/streamtuner.xml
-share/gnome/omf/streamtuner/streamtuner-C.omf
-@exec scrollkeeper-install -q %D/share/gnome/omf/streamtuner/streamtuner-C.omf 2>/dev/null || /usr/bin/true
-share/gnome/pixmaps/streamtuner.png
-share/gnome/streamtuner/ui/applications.png
-share/gnome/streamtuner/ui/bookmarks.png
-share/gnome/streamtuner/ui/browse.png
-share/gnome/streamtuner/ui/category-open-running.png
-share/gnome/streamtuner/ui/category-open.png
-share/gnome/streamtuner/ui/category-running.png
-share/gnome/streamtuner/ui/category.png
-%%LIVE365%%share/gnome/streamtuner/ui/live365.png
-%%LOCAL%%share/gnome/streamtuner/ui/local.png
-share/gnome/streamtuner/ui/logo.png
-share/gnome/streamtuner/ui/main-category-running.png
-share/gnome/streamtuner/ui/main-category.png
-share/gnome/streamtuner/ui/preselections.png
-%%PYTHON%%share/gnome/streamtuner/ui/python.png
-share/gnome/streamtuner/ui/record.png
-share/gnome/streamtuner/ui/search-category-running.png
-share/gnome/streamtuner/ui/search-category.png
-share/gnome/streamtuner/ui/search.png
-%%SHOUTCAST%%share/gnome/streamtuner/ui/shoutcast.png
-share/gnome/streamtuner/ui/streamtuner.png
-share/gnome/streamtuner/ui/tune-in.png
-%%XIPH%%share/gnome/streamtuner/ui/xiph.png
-%%PYTHON%%share/gnome/streamtuner/python/icons/basic.ch.png
-%%PYTHON%%share/gnome/streamtuner/python/icons/google-stations.png
-%%PYTHON%%share/gnome/streamtuner/python/icons/punkcast.com.png
-%%PYTHON%%share/gnome/streamtuner/python/scripts/basic.ch.py
-%%PYTHON%%share/gnome/streamtuner/python/scripts/google-stations.py
-%%PYTHON%%share/gnome/streamtuner/python/scripts/punkcast.com.py
share/locale/de/LC_MESSAGES/streamtuner.mo
share/locale/fr/LC_MESSAGES/streamtuner.mo
share/locale/hu/LC_MESSAGES/streamtuner.mo
share/locale/ja/LC_MESSAGES/streamtuner.mo
share/locale/pt/LC_MESSAGES/streamtuner.mo
-@dirrm include/streamtuner
-@dirrm lib/streamtuner/plugins
-@dirrm lib/streamtuner
-@dirrm share/doc/streamtuner
+share/omf/streamtuner/streamtuner-C.omf
+share/pixmaps/streamtuner.png
+share/streamtuner/ui/applications.png
+share/streamtuner/ui/bookmarks.png
+share/streamtuner/ui/browse.png
+share/streamtuner/ui/category-open-running.png
+share/streamtuner/ui/category-open.png
+share/streamtuner/ui/category-running.png
+share/streamtuner/ui/category.png
+%%LIVE365%%share/streamtuner/ui/live365.png
+%%LOCAL%%share/streamtuner/ui/local.png
+share/streamtuner/ui/logo.png
+share/streamtuner/ui/main-category-running.png
+share/streamtuner/ui/main-category.png
+share/streamtuner/ui/preselections.png
+%%PYTHON%%share/streamtuner/ui/python.png
+share/streamtuner/ui/record.png
+share/streamtuner/ui/search-category-running.png
+share/streamtuner/ui/search-category.png
+share/streamtuner/ui/search.png
+%%SHOUTCAST%%share/streamtuner/ui/shoutcast.png
+share/streamtuner/ui/streamtuner.png
+share/streamtuner/ui/tune-in.png
+%%XIPH%%share/streamtuner/ui/xiph.png
+%%PYTHON%%share/streamtuner/python/icons/basic.ch.png
+%%PYTHON%%share/streamtuner/python/icons/google-stations.png
+%%PYTHON%%share/streamtuner/python/icons/punkcast.com.png
+%%PYTHON%%share/streamtuner/python/scripts/basic.ch.py
+%%PYTHON%%share/streamtuner/python/scripts/google-stations.py
+%%PYTHON%%share/streamtuner/python/scripts/punkcast.com.py
+@dirrm share/streamtuner/ui
+%%PYTHON%%@dirrm share/streamtuner/python/scripts
+%%PYTHON%%@dirrm share/streamtuner/python/icons
+%%PYTHON%%@dirrm share/streamtuner/python
+@dirrm share/streamtuner
+@dirrm share/omf/streamtuner
@dirrm share/gnome/help/streamtuner/C/figures
@dirrm share/gnome/help/streamtuner/C
@dirrm share/gnome/help/streamtuner
-@dirrm share/gnome/omf/streamtuner
-@unexec scrollkeeper-uninstall -q %D/share/gnome/omf/streamtuner/streamtuner-C.omf 2>/dev/null || /usr/bin/true
-@dirrm share/gnome/streamtuner/ui
-%%PYTHON%%@dirrm share/gnome/streamtuner/python/icons
-%%PYTHON%%@dirrm share/gnome/streamtuner/python/scripts
-%%PYTHON%%@dirrm share/gnome/streamtuner/python
-@dirrm share/gnome/streamtuner
+@dirrm share/doc/streamtuner
+@dirrm lib/streamtuner/plugins
+@dirrm lib/streamtuner
+@dirrm include/streamtuner
+@dirrmtry share/applications